Cost Breakdown: Is Private Transport Worth It?
Now, alright, let’s talk prices. Private transport naturally costs quite a bit more than hopping on a public bus, right? Think paying somewhere in the area of $150-$300 USD for the service, in a way depending on the company, the sort of vehicle, plus any customizations of the plan you are after. However, arguably divide that cost amongst a group, and suddenly that seems a bit easier to justify. If you’re after an itemized breakdown, very expect that most prices take in the driver’s payment, all the fuel expenses, as well as vehicle maintenance.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
What is the best time to visit Colca Canyon?
The dry season (April to October) is usually preferred for the best weather and viewing conditions. Yet prepare for cold nights, though those mornings have blue sunny skies.
